
Thursday, April 22, 6-7:30 PM – WASTED: Small Efforts for Big Change. Hosted by the Rockfall Foundation, City of Middletown, Wesleyan Sustainability Office and RiverCOG. Join us for part 5 of a 7-part series of conversations about waste, environmental justice, and how we all play a part in the future of sustainability. This Thursday we’ll hear about environmental advocacy from panelists Lou Rosado Burch (CT Program Director, Citizen's Campaign for the Environment), Marilynn Cruz-Aponte (Assistant Director, East Hartford Department of Public Works), and Kevin Budris (Attorney, Zero Waste Project, Conservation Law Foundation).Registration required: https://us02web.zoom.us/meetin...
Saturday, April 24, 9:00 - 11:00 a.m. Earth Day Paper Shred Event at Veteran's Memorial Park, Walnut Grove Road. Middletown residents only. 6 box or bag limit. Residential sensitive documents only. No businesses please. All materials will be shredded on site and recycled.
